Associate an Existing Agenda to a Calendar Event

Prev Next

This article will show you how to associate an existing Agenda with a Calendar event.

Who can use this feature?

System Administrator | Owner | Publisher

Instructions

  1. Sign in to your site

  2. Navigate to Modules, then Content, and then Agenda Center:

    A menu showing various modules with 'Agenda Center' highlighted for easy access.

  3. Select a category:

    An Agenda Center displaying various boards with agenda counts and submission statuses.

  4. Navigate to the Agendas tab:

    City Council agenda overview with meeting dates and descriptions listed for review. The Agendas tab is highlighted.

  5. Click Actions for the agenda you want to associate:

    Agenda Center interface displaying upcoming City Council meeting details and action options. The Actions button is highlighted.

  6. Select Copy to Calendar Event:

    City Council agenda with options to modify, copy, and archive meeting details. The Copy to Calendar Event option is highlighted.

  7. On the pop-up, select the calendar you would like to link to, then click the Next button:

    Popup window for adding an agenda link, highlighting City Council and the Next button.

  8. Select the event that will receive the link to the Agenda, then click the Add Agenda Link to Event button:
